Right of way disregarded: Two injured and major damage in Bruck accident!
On Friday evening, November 2nd, 2025, the emergency services from the BRK and the fire department were called to a traffic accident in Bruck at 5:20 p.m. At the junction of state road 2150 with the municipal connection road to Schöngras there was a serious incident in which a 42-year-old BMW driver from Munich disregarded the right of way of a 20-year-old Volvo driver from the district. The BMW was on its way from the direction of Schöngras and wanted to turn onto State Road 2150 when the accident happened.
A total of four people were injured in the accident, with the driver of the BMW suffering minor injuries. Fortunately, the other two occupants of the BMW remained uninjured. The Volvo driver suffered a similar fate and was taken to a nearby hospital with minor injuries as a precaution. The amount of damage at the scene of the accident amounts to around 40,000 euros, which is no small amount for such an incident, as [mittelbayerische.de](https://www.mittelbayerische.de/lokales/landkreis-schwandorf/vorfahrt-missächte-zwei-verleute-und-hoher-sach Schaden-bei-unfall-in-bruck-19844821) reports.
The role of the fire department
The Bruck fire department quickly arrived at the scene of the accident and took over both traffic control and cleaning of the area affected by the accident.
